Opening of art exhibition “REVIVE” at American International School

April 16, 2012

Share

AIS Visual Arts teacher Angie Hani (in the middle)

The American International School of Kuwait’s Visual Arts Department is constantly growing and developing. Our focus for our high school students has been on the conceptual links with the student’s body of works and their artistic technical skills and processes to reflect these themes and ideas visually. Students are constantly encouraged to go beyond their comfort zones and explore a variety of multimedia approaches whilst also refining conventional artistic practices. We educate our students beyond the classroom by inviting in local artists for “An afternoon with an artist”, where students are able to meet, watch, listen and question well established artists in practice.
